Energy audit services involve a comprehensive assessment of a property's energy consumption and efficiency. Skilled professionals examine various aspects of a building, including insulation, heating and cooling systems, lighting, and appliances, to identify areas where energy is being wasted. The goal is to gather detailed data that highlights opportunities for improving energy use, reducing costs, and enhancing overall performance. These audits often include measurements, inspections, and analysis to provide a clear understanding of how energy flows through a property.
These services help address common issues such as high utility bills, uneven indoor temperatures, and inefficient system operation. By pinpointing specific areas of energy loss, property owners can implement targeted improvements that lead to cost savings and better comfort. Energy audits also assist in identifying outdated or malfunctioning equipment that may be consuming excessive energy. Ultimately, the insights gained from an audit enable informed decisions about upgrades, repairs, or modifications to optimize energy efficiency.

The overview below groups typical Energy Audit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waltham,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Assessment Costs - The cost for a comprehensive energy audit typ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the property's size and complexity. Larger commercial buildings may incur higher fees, sometimes exceeding $1,000.
Diagnostic Equipment Fees - Using specialized diagnostic tools can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These tools help identify energy inefficiencies and pinpoint areas for improvement.
Follow-up and Recommendations - Some service providers include a detailed report with recommendations at no extra charge, while others may charge an additional $50 to $200 for a written assessment.
Additional Services and Testing - Optional tests such as blower door testing or infrared scanning can cost between $150 and $400. These services provide deeper insights into building performance and potential energy savings.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an energy audit service? An energy audit service assesses a property's energy use and identifies opportunities to improve efficiency by analyzing insulation, heating, cooling, and lighting systems.
How can an energy audit benefit my property? An energy audit can help identify areas where energy consumption can be reduced, potentially lowering utility bills and improving overall energy performance.
Who provides energy audit services? Local contractors and service providers specializing in energy efficiency conduct these audits to evaluate properties in Waltham, MA, and nearby areas.
What should I expect during an energy audit? During an audit, professionals will evaluate your property's energy systems, inspect insulation, and may perform tests to determine energy loss points.
